Pakistan to hunt Afghan Taliban chief’s assist to manage TTP

PESHAWAR: A determined Pakistan has sought Afghan Taliban chief Haibuttallah Akhundzada‘s assist to rein within the outlawed Pakistani Taliban outfit answerable for a wave of terror assaults within the nation, together with the latest Peshawar mosque carnage that killed over 100 folks, in keeping with a media report on Saturday.
Pakistan has been hit by a wave of terrorism, principally within the nation’s Khyber Pakhtunkhwa province, but additionally in Balochistan and the Punjab city of Mianwali, which borders the restive Khyber Pakhtunkhwa province.
Within the Peshawar mosque assault on Monday, a Taliban suicide bomber blew himself up in the course of the afternoon prayers, killing 101 folks and injuring greater than 200 others.
In the course of the Apex Committee assembly right here on Friday, Pakistan’s civil and navy management determined to hunt Afghan Taliban chief Haibuttallah Akhundzada’s intervention to manage the Tehreek-e-Taliban Pakistan (TTP), in keeping with The Categorical Tribune newspaper.
Pakistan’s inside minister Rana Sanaullah, who attended Friday’s assembly, mentioned the masterminds of the Peshawar Mosque assault could possibly be in Afghanistan, and added that the federal authorities would increase this difficulty with their Afghan counterparts, the report mentioned.
Pakistan Prime Minister Shehbaz Sharif on Friday acknowledged the failure to avert the Peshawar carnage that killed over 100 folks and referred to as for “nationwide unity” to deal with the menace.
“There’s a want for unity throughout the political spectrum. This act of terrorism managed to breach the safety test put up and attain the mosque. We must always not really feel hesitant in admitting the details,” Sharif mentioned on the assembly.
In the meantime, Pakistani authorities claimed to have made an “vital breakthrough” in its probe into the Peshawar Mosque assault by figuring out the suicide bomber by means of his DNA samples.
Police mentioned the DNA check was performed and the investigators are attempting to hint the household of the bomber.
In November final yr, the TTP referred to as off an indefinite ceasefire agreed with the federal government in June 2022 and ordered its militants to hold out assaults on the safety forces.
The TTP, which is believed to have shut hyperlinks to al-Qaeda, has threatened to focus on high leaders of Prime Minister Sharif’s PML-N and international minister Bilawal Bhutto-Zardari’s PPP if the ruling coalition continued to implement strict measures towards the militants.
Pakistan hoped that the Afghan Taliban after coming to energy would cease the usage of their soil towards Pakistan by expelling the TTP operatives however they’ve apparently refused to take action at the price of straining ties with Islamabad.
The TTP, arrange as an umbrella group of a number of militant outfits in 2007, referred to as off a ceasefire with the federal authorities and ordered its militants to stage terrorist assaults throughout the nation.
The group, which is believed to be near al-Qaeda, has been blamed for a number of lethal assaults throughout Pakistan, together with an assault on military headquarters in 2009, assaults on navy bases, and the 2008 bombing of the Marriott Lodge in Islamabad.
In 2014, the Pakistani Taliban stormed the Military Public Faculty (APS) within the northwestern metropolis of Peshawar, killing no less than 150 folks, together with 131 college students.
Monday’s lethal assault has despatched shockwaves internationally and was broadly condemned.
